The festival season returns this year to take over the state with some of the world’s biggest events including Adelaide Fringe, Adelaide Festival, WOMADelaide and East End Unleashed.
Festivals in Adelaide will begin with Adelaide Fringe, running from Friday 21 February to Sunday 23 March 2025.
To help event goers get to and from festivals in Adelaide, the ADLOOP CBD tram loop service will be operating for the duration of the festival season. Additional O-Bahn services will run to and from the city each weekend at a higher frequency, and a dedicated bus shuttle will also operate during WOMADelaide 2025.
Road closures and detours will be in place each weekend of the festival season for the City of Adelaide’s East End Unleashed event.

The ADLOOP is a special tram service that will loop the north, east and south ends of the city during the festival season.
This service will operate on Friday and Saturday nights, starting on Friday 21 February 2025. The ADLOOP services will also operate on Sunday 9 March 2025 for the Adelaide Cup long weekend.
Timetables:
The ADLOOP tram service will operate on a weekday and weekend timetable.
The weekday timetable will operate on Friday nights, beginning on Friday 21 February to Friday 21 March 2025.
The weekend timetable will operate on Saturday nights, beginning on Saturday 22 February to Saturday 22 March 2025. This service will also operate on Sunday 9 March 2025 of the Adelaide Cup long weekend.

The City of Adelaide’s East End Unleashed event will be held on each weekend of the festival season.
Road closures will be in place on Rundle Street, East Terrace and Rundle Road every Friday, Saturday and Sunday of the festival season, which may cause several detours.

Taxi Ranks:
From Thursday 20 February to 1:00 am Monday 24 March 2025, there will be a temporary taxi rank on the eastern side of East Terrace between Botanic Road, Rundle Road and Grenfell Street.
The permanent taxi rank between Botanic Road and Rundle Road on the eastern side of East Terrace will operate as normal.
Passenger Loading:
Every Friday to Sunday during the Festival season, there will be a temporary passenger loading zone from 6:00 am to 6:00 pm. This will be located on the western side of East Terrace between Botanic Road and southern side of Rundle Road.
